We conduct a thorough analysis of the corporate structure of potential business partners or acquisition targets. Our analysis includes verifying corporate ownership, reviewing governance structures, identifying liabilities, and ensuring compliance with local laws.
Saudi Arabia’s real estate laws can be complex, especially for foreign investors. We help you assess property ownership rights, zoning regulations, land-use compliance, and environmental risks. With our services, you can avoid costly legal issues related to land titles, zoning, and development permissions.
Saudi Arabia has a highly regulated business environment. We assess whether your potential partner or acquisition target complies with local regulations, including labor laws, intellectual property protections, and taxation policies. Our in-depth checks ensure that you are not exposed to any hidden compliance issues.
Tax laws in Saudi Arabia are nuanced and constantly evolving. We conduct thorough tax due diligence to uncover potential tax liabilities, confirm tax compliance, and review tax optimization strategies. This service ensures your investment is not burdened with unexpected tax risks.
We assess the terms and conditions of existing contracts, including supply agreements, lease contracts, and customer contracts. Our legal review helps you identify potential risks, including clauses that could affect your legal standing in the future.
Understanding ongoing or potential litigation is essential before committing to any legal agreement. We provide a detailed report on any current or potential disputes that could impact your decision to move forward.
While not strictly legal, understanding the financial health of a business is crucial for legal due diligence. We collaborate with financial experts to assess potential financial risks, uncover undisclosed debts, and ensure the business has no hidden financial liabilities.
Investing or partnering with a Saudi business requires a thorough understanding of the local legal environment, including foreign ownership laws and local partnership regulations. We ensure that all agreements comply with Saudi laws to protect your interests and avoid conflicts.

A due diligence report typically includes an assessment of corporate structure, financial health, regulatory compliance, tax obligations, intellectual property rights, and any ongoing litigation or disputes.
The process can vary depending on the complexity of the transaction but typically takes between 4-8 weeks for a thorough analysis.
Common issues include undisclosed debts, unregistered property titles, non-compliance with local regulations, and potential legal disputes that could affect the value of a business.
